2017 All-Bi-City 4A-7A Baseball Team announced
As part of the 2017 All-Bi-City 4A-7A Baseball Team, one player was chosen as Player of the Year and one was chosen as Pitcher of the Year. One local coach was selected as Coach of the Year.
Along with these three individuals, 15 players were selected to First Team, 14 were chosen to Second Team and 11 were named to Honorable Mention.
